【答案】1. B 2. C 3. C 4. C 5. A 6. B 7. A 8. A 9. C 10. A
【解析】
【导语】本文讲述班级乘公交去敬老院做志愿活动的经历,感悟志愿活动的意义并呼吁大家参与。
【1题详解】
句意:上个周末,我们班乘坐公交车去了敬老院。
空后为交通工具“bus”,固定搭配by bus表示“乘坐公交车”,by后直接接交通工具单数名词。in和on接交通工具时需加冠词或限定词,不符合该固定用法。
【2题详解】
句意:我们中的一些人打扫他们的房间,一些人和他们交谈并讲述有趣的生活故事,还有一些人给花园里的花浇水。
空后出现“with them”,固定搭配talk with sb.表示“与某人交谈”,符合和老人聊天的语境。speak后常接语言,say后多接具体说话内容,不符合语境。
【3题详解】
句意:从这次经历中,我明白了志愿活动不仅对他人有益,对自己也有好处。
空后为“this experience”,结合语境是从经历中获得感悟,From有“从……中”的含义。For“为了”,With“和……一起”,都不符合逻辑语义。
【4题详解】
句意:它帮助我成长为一个更好的人。
文章整体以一般现在时叙事,主语“It”为第三人称单数,谓语动词要用第三人称单数形式helps。
【5题详解】
句意:每个人都应该在空闲时间做一些志愿工作。
根据“Everyone...do some volunteer work”可知,作者在此提出建议,should表示“应该”,适合用于倡导提议。must语气过于强硬表必须,can’t“不可以”,不符合倡议的语境。
【6题详解】
句意:我们可以学会独立解决问题,真正懂得给予的意义。
固定搭配by oneself表示“独自、靠自己”,主语为We,对应的反身代词是ourselves;themselves对应复数第三人称,yourselves对应第二人称,和主语人称不匹配。
【7题详解】
句意:音乐和志愿活动都让我们的日常生活更加丰富多彩。
结合文章积极的基调,colorful表示“丰富多彩的”,符合语境。dull“无聊的”,usual“平常的”,都和正向表达的文意不符。
【8题详解】
句意:如果我们有机会去帮助有需要的人,我们应该尽全力去做,并享受生活的美好。
前后句为假设逻辑,If引导条件状语从句表“如果”。Because引导原因状语从句,Though引导让步状语从句,逻辑关系不契合。
【9题详解】
句意:生活在这样一个温暖的世界里真的是一件美好的事情。
空后为“a wonderful thing”,really为副词可修饰形容词和名词,表“真正地”。so后常接形容词再接that从句,very一般不直接修饰带冠词的名词短语,用法不匹配。
【10题详解】
句意:让我们从小事做起,让我们的生活更有意义。
make后接宾语加形容词作宾语补足语,meaningful是形容词“有意义的”。meaning是名词,mean是动词,都不符合语法词性要求。

B.Choose the best answer (根据内容选择最恰当的答案)
Body language is important in communication. However, the same body language can have very different meanings in different cultures. Here are some examples:
Nodding your head usually means “yes.”
But in Bulgaria (保加利亚) and Greece, nodding up and down means “no.”
In the West, people like to look at each other when they talk. Strong eye contact is very common in Spain, Greece and Arab (阿拉伯的) countries.
Finns (芬兰人) and Japanese are embarrassed when others stare at them during a talk. They only make eye contact at the start of a discussion.
Tapping (轻敲) your nose means “secret” in England.
In Italy, the same gesture means “be careful.”
In many cultures, like Italy and the U.S., people use their arms freely when talking. They often wave their arms.
Northern Europeans don’t like gesturing with their arms. They think it shows insincerity and is too dramatic. In Japan, gesturing with broad arm movements is thought to be impolite.
Sitting cross-legged is common in North America and European countries.
________
In many countries in Asia and the Middle East, sitting like this is disrespectful.

D.Read the passage and complete the tasks. (根据短文内容完成任务)
Saying “sorry” is a powerful part of communication. Sometimes we hurt others by chance—maybe we pay no attention to their words or act. Admitting (承认) our mistakes and apologizing can fix misunderstandings, but finding the right words isn’t always easy. It takes courage to say we’re wrong!
There are many sincere ways to apologize. You can write a sincere note, give a small meaningful gift, or simply speak from your heart. Phrases like “I’m sorry if I upset you” or “Thank you for listening—I didn’t mean to be rude” show you care. A genuine (真诚的) apology isn’t just words; it’s showing you understand how the other person feels.
Why is apologizing so important for good communication? It helps fix hurt feelings and build strong relationships. When we say sorry honestly, we tell others we treasure them more than being “right”. Even if it’s hard to speak up, apologizing makes both people feel better in the end. It’s a key skill for getting along with friends and family.
Last week, Mia argued with her best friend Lila because she wasn’t listening during their chat. Lila felt sad and stopped talking to her. After thinking for a day, Mia decided to apologize. She wrote a card saying how sorry she was and asked Lila to forgive her. When Lila read the card, she smiled. Mia realized that good communication isn’t just talking—it’s also knowing when to say sorry. Next time she has a misunderstanding with someone, ________.
